BOSH
Cloud Foundry BOSH is an open source tool for release engineering, deployment, lifecycle management, and monitoring of distributed systems.
This repository is a Bosh Release, providing the necessary binaries and configuration templates for deploying a new Bosh Director instance, as instructed by some Bosh deployment manifest, to be applied by some Bosh CLI invocation or a pre-existing Bosh Director instance.
Quick start
Bosh is deployed by Bosh, and in order to bootstrap a new Bosh server from
scratch, the Bosh CLI acts as a lightweight Bosh server with the
bosh create-env command. Please refer to this
Quick Start installation guide for more
details.
